Synthesis ,characterization and antibacterial activity of mixed ligand complexes of some metals with 1-nitroso-2-naphthol and L-phenylalanine

Abstract
The mixed ligand complexes of Mn(II),Fe(II ), Co(II),Ni(II),Cu(II), Zn(II) and Cd (II) with 1-nitroso-2-naphthol (C 10 H 7 NO 2 ), symbolized (NNPhH)] and amino acid L-phenylalanine ( C 9 H 10 NO 2 ) , symbolized ( phe H),  were synthesized and characterized by: Melting points, Solubility, Molar conductivity. determination the percentage of the metal in the complexes by flame(AAS), Molecular weight determined by  Rast’s Camphor method, susceptibility measurements, Spectroscopic Method [FT-IR and UV-Vis], And Program  [Chem office– CS .Chem.– 3D pro 2006] was used for draw compounds . The results showed that the deprotonated   two  ligands acts as a bidentate ligand ,  ( phe - ) was coordinated to the metal ions through the oxygen  of  the  carboxylic  group  and  the nitrogen of the amine and  the 1-nitroso-2-naphthol ligand was coordinated to the metal ions through the oxygen and nitrogen atoms. The electronic absorption spectra and magnetic susceptibility measurements of the complexes indicate octahedral geometry for all the complexes.
